Theorizing that one could time travel within his own lifetime, Dr. Sam
Beckett stepped into the quantum leap accelerator and vanished. He awoke
to find himself trapped in the past, facing mirror images that were not
his own and driven by an unknown force to change history for the better.
His only guide on this journey is Al, an observer from his own time, who
appears in the form of a hologram that only Sam can see and hear. And so
Dr. Beckett finds himself leaping from life to life, striving to put right
what once went wrong and hoping each time that his next leap will be the
leap home.





ENTER SCENE

(A blue glow surrounds Dr. Sam Beckett and then fades as he leaps into a
new body.)

Sam: (Disoriented) What..."Who am I?"

Al: "According to Ziggy, you're Joe Smith, a Technical Writer in Topeka
Kansas."

Sam: "Well, what's my assignment?"

Al: (Banging on his hand-held Palm III) "Um...well...according to Ziggy,
your job is to finish documenting a technical manual for Zybec's new
resource-tracking application. Hey, this doesn't sound so bad! Just chat
with a few programmers, skim over their finished software product...that'll
give you a solid understanding the system. Then write the manual with a
computer or something, pass it to your manager, and be on your way. Sound's
like a cake walk.

Sam: Yeah, I guess...

Al: A technical writer...hey aren't those like the guys who wrote the
manual for the Quantum Leap Accelerator?

Sam: Yup.

Al: Oh boy...

END SCENE
